How to make money from a blog: tips and tools

Launching your own blog can seem a daunting prospect. But what if we told you that you could make money from a blog? With the right tips and tools it can quickly become a profitable endeavor. Blogs have a considerable impact on the web, with over 1.6 billion* of them being written around the world. Blogs have become a popular means of sharing information, promoting products and services, showcasing brands and building online communities.

In this article, we share our tips and tricks for creating a profitable blog🤑

Infographic: The Position of Blogs in the Market

What is a blog?

The term “blog” is a contraction of “web log,” meaning an online journal. A blog is a website (or a section of one) dedicated to publishing a steady stream of articles; these may cover a variety of topics, either pertaining to a niche area of interest or reporting on news and events in a specific subject. For a little history, the first blog was started in 1994 by Justin Hall.

There are several types of blogs: 

  • Personal blog;
  • Professional blog;
  • News blog;
  • Niche blog; 
  • Company blog;
  • etc.

Why should you start a blog? 🤔

There are multiple advantages to starting a blog, whether you want to express yourself or develop an online presence for professional purposes. Here are a few good reasons to start a blog:

  • Become an expert: blogging in a specific niche topic gives you the opportunity to become an expert in this field. You can create informative and useful content, attracting an audience that shares your passion.
  • Monetize your expertise: by specializing in a niche topic, you can create opportunities for monetization. Companies are prepared to pay for access to niche audiences, which can generate revenues through advertising, affiliate partnerships and other methods.
  • Build a community: blogs allow you to build an online community. You can interact with your readers, answer their questions and build long-term relationships.

In summary, starting a blog (particularly in a niche area or specialist field) offers a unique opportunity. You can share your passion, become a recognized expert, develop an engaged audience, generate revenues and leave an enduring legacy on the web.

How to start and to make money from a blog?

There are several ways to create a blog, but let’s focus on the key points.✨If you want something actionable, here’s a to-do list that will help your blog to shine; whether you’re aiming to boost traffic, your reputation or conversion rates, this list is for you!

Finding a niche 🔎

The first step in starting an income-generating blog is to find a topic in a specific area of interest. For example, you might start a blog on cooking, finance, marketing or travel.

  • Research target subjects relevant to your passions and skill set;
  • Use keyword search tools to assess demand;
  • Identify gaps in the content available on this topic.

To identify the most engaging search queries for your topic, you can use tools like: 

Creating quality content

Creating quality content in keeping with the E-E-A-T principle (Experience, Expertise, Authority and Trustworthiness) is essential for the success of your blog. To do so, you should study your personas attentively and create content that is engaging, informative and useful for your readers. The strategic use of key words is also crucial for attracting organic traffic. Here are a few tips for maintaining a high level of quality in your content:

👉 Provide original and relevant information;
👉 Use statistics and reliable data to back up your arguments;
👉 Write interesting headlines that will grab readers’ attention;
👉 Include expert opinions and videos within your articles.

— Google Search Central (@googlesearchc)

Search Engine Optimization (SEO)

Search engine optimization is an essential consideration. Use striking titles and relevant meta-descriptions, and be sure to include external and internal links in order to improve your blog’s Google ranking. Here are a few tips for improving your SEO:

  • Perform an in-depth keyword search;
  • Use headings (H1, H2, H3) to structure your content;
  • Ensure images are appropriately sized, and that they contain ALT tags;
  • Keep an eye on evolving SEO trends.

Top 3 tools for optimizing your content 💥

Invest in attractive design

Investing in an attractive page design is crucial to the success of your blog. A well-designed site not only holds visitors’ attention better, but also improves the experience, which can result in higher reader loyalty and conversion rates.

Here are a few rules to abide by in order to ensure quality blog design:

✅ The importance of first impressions: the first few seconds are the most important, and an aesthetically pleasing design can enhance your blog’s credibility and generate user interest;
✅ Ease of navigation: visitors need to be able to find what they’re looking for quickly, whether it’s a specific article, contact information, or the products you sell. Fluid navigation contributes to an improved user experience;
✅ Responsive design: your blog should be adapted to all device types: mobile, desktop computer, tablets, etc. A responsive design guarantees that your blog will offer an optimal experience on all screen types, which helps keep visitors engaged.

The Adrenalead #PushTeam shares its favorite ❤️ tools for starting a blog:

infographic of the best tools for blogging

Promotion via social networks

Create a presence on social networks so you can regularly share your content. Engage with your audience to develop your online community. Here are a few tips for promoting your blog on social media:

  • Use images and videos to attract attention.
  • Interact with your subscribers by responding to their comments.
  • Plan your publications in order to maintain coherence.

 Audience monetization

Monetization is something you should think about before starting your blog; this is why it’s essential to choose a niche and find a good name. There are various methods of audience monetization to explore, including online advertising, affiliate marketing, Web Push Notifications and the sale of digital products, in order to make money from your blog. Below are a few effective monetization strategies:

  • Use Google AdSense to display relevant ads on your blog;
  • Join affiliate programs with a connection to your niche;
  • Create digital products such as ebooks or online courses;
  • Use Web Push Notifications to interact with your audience and generate marketing revenue outside your site, directly on web users’ screens

📌 You can consult our detailed guide on audience monetization, which includes several actionable strategies for your audience.

Performance monitoring and analysis

For 21% of bloggers, the question of whether or not their blog is generating value remains unanswered. The use of analytical tools such as Google Analytics and SEMrush is the best approach for getting accurate insights, and adapting your strategy based on the data collected. With this approach, it’s essential to carefully choose the performance indicators (KPIs) that reflect your objectives and your audience’s key interests.

Here are 5 KPIs you should keep a close eye on👀

  • Sessions: this is the n°1 indicator to monitor, as it measures your site’s overall traffic; i.e. the total number of visitors to your blog;
  • SEO ranking: track your blog’s positioning for target keywords, in order to ensure that your blog is correctly optimized for search engines;
  • Number of new visitors: for keeping an eye on your audience growth;
  • The bounce rate: a high bounce rate can indicate an issue with your content or navigation. Identify pages with high bounce rates and improve them;
  • Popular articles: allows you to orient your editorial strategy based on your most-viewed topics.

Time management

Time management is an essential component in the success of your blog. You need to be able to plan your work efficiently, publish articles on a regular basis and stay organized in order to achieve your objectives. Here are a few key points to take into consideration in terms of time management for your blog:

📌 Content planning: take the time to plan your content in advance. Establish an editorial calendar to define the subjects, dates of publication and objectives associated with each article;
📌 Maintain consistency: regularity is essential in order to build audience loyalty. Set a realistic publication schedule based on your resource levels, and stick to it. Don’t forget that every objective should be SMART;
📌 Prioritize tasks: identify which tasks are most pressing for your blog’s success, and give them priority. This may involve keyword searches, writing flagship articles, promotion on social media, or search engine optimization and monetization.

Our top tools for managing your creative time 🔥

make money from a blog notion tool logo


❤️The team’s favorite

Make money from a blog: conclusion

Creating a blog takes time and if you wish to make money from this blog, perseverance and a carefully thought-out strategy. By following these tips and using the right tools, you can achieve online success and harness the full potential offered by blogs.

Our top practical tips 🚀

  • Actively share your content on social media, in relevant groups, and via newsletters to attract new visitors;
  • Create quality backlinks through collaborations with other blogs, or by contributing to publications featured on leading websites in your field;
  • Collaborate with other bloggers or experts in your niche in order to reach new audiences and expand your readership;
  • Analyze pages with a high bounce rate and make improvements, such as the addition of internal links to other relevant articles;
  • Identify subjects and content types (tutorials, lists, case studies, etc.) that work best for your audience. Continue producing this type of content.


1. How much time does it take to start making money with a blog?

Timeframes vary, but in general it takes 6 months to a year before you start making significant income.

2. What’s the best platform for starting a blog?

WordPress is the most popular and versatile blogging platform. It’s free and open-source, which means you can use and modify it however you like.

3.  Do I need to invest money to start a blog?

Yes, you might need to invest in web hosting and other tools, but the costs are generally manageable.

4.  What are the most useful analysis tools for bloggers?

Google Analytics and Google Search Console are among the most useful tools for tracking performance and improving SEO for free. There are also paid tools like SEMrush and Ahrefs, which are powerful tools if you want to take the analysis further.

5. What’s the most effective method for generating revenues?

Online marketing and affiliate marketing are often the simplest methods for bloggers who are just starting out. However, a number of other levers exists for those seeking to stand out from the crowd, including Web Push Notifications.

📤 Share: